The Royal Dutch Cricket Association (KNCB) has announced a partnership with Tachyon Security, a provider of managed cybersecurity and network operations solutions.
The Rijswijk, South Holland–based company will thus act as an associate sponsor of the Netherlands men’s national cricket team at the 2026 ICC Men’s T20 World Cup.
Tachyon Security also has in place an agreement with the Netherlands women’s national cricket team, who will take part in the 2026 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up later this year.
Lucas Hendrikse, CEO of the KNCB, commented:
“We are delighted to have Tachyon Security as an associate sponsor of Dutch men’s cricket. Their valued support will not only benefit the national team but will also help us further develop cricket in the Netherlands.”
Michael Connelly, Tachyon Security, said:
“We are delighted to support the Dutch men’s cricket team. The journey of this team has been remarkable, causing upsets throughout their T20 World Cup history including wins over England and South Africa. Their passion, ambition, talent, and a relentless focus on improvement are qualities we recognise and respect at Tachyon Security. We are proud to stand behind the team as they pursue their next milestone at the upcoming T20 World Cup in India and Sri Lanka.”
